Transaction 36782ea55c8868587c5d883c212941201c313279616bfe3df914c55078a51cc9
1 Input
1 Output
-
36782ea55c8868587c5d883c212941201c313279616bfe3df914c55078a51cc9:0
- value
- 29010603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ed1d159184226f4c3754e9e2f976e9b1581826a9 OP_EQUAL
- address
- 3PJkupKxBSFtrFn3zLaeJRBUWh9ktLHcuK